Patent number: 8615974Abstract: An article bagging apparatus designed to reduce impacts caused by stopping at advance and retraction terminal points. The article bagging apparatus has an upper scoop (12) and a lower scoop (14) rectilinearly movable forward and backward together. The upper and lower scoops are advanced and inserted into a bag through an opening thereof, and the upper scoop is displaced upward, thereby expanding the bag vertically. In addition, the upper and lower scoops are retracted to pull the expanded bag, thereby allowing an article placed in the path of retraction to enter the bag. The article bagging apparatus includes a coupling unit (22) that allows the upper scoop to be displaced vertically and that causes the upper and lower scoops to move together forward and backward, an upper guide rail (24) supporting the upper scoop horizontally movably, and an upper drive unit (26) vertically moving the upper guide rail.Type: GrantFiled: September 28, 2010Date of Patent: December 31, 2013Assignee: Oshikiri Machinery Ltd.Inventors: Nobuhiro Suzuki, Michinori Watanabe, Shuichi Iribe, Seiichi Akutsu

Patent number: 4722917Abstract: An anti-I sorbent which comprises as I blood group substances at least two materials selected from the group consisting of mucin and milk derived from Eutheria and ovomucoid from Ornithurae. The use of the anti-I sorbent inhibits the formation of false positive agglutination caused by anti-I autoantibody.Type: GrantFiled: February 7, 1985Date of Patent: February 2, 1988Assignee: Seitetsu Kagaku Co., Ltd.Inventors: Taiko Seno, Yasuto Okubo, Masao Kawamura, Seiichi Akutsu, Hirosuke Fukuda

Patent number: 4604349Abstract: A process for preparing uridine diphosphate-N-acetylgalactosamine, which comprises treating a reaction solution obtained by the enzymatic conversion of uridine diphosphate-N-acetylglucosamine to uridine diphosphate-N-acetylgalactosamine, with uridine diphosphate-N-acetylglucosamine pyrophosphorylase to decompose the remaining uridine diphosphate-N-acetylglucosamine in the solution and then separating therefrom the uridine diphosphate-N-acetylgalactosamine for purification. In one aspect of this invention, it relates to a method for measuring the activity of .alpha.-N-acetylgalactosaminyl transferase characterized by the use of said reaction solution as the substrate for the transferase.Type: GrantFiled: February 25, 1985Date of Patent: August 5, 1986Assignee: Seitetsu Kagaku Co., Ltd.Inventors: Taiko Seno, Yasuto Okubo, Masao Kawamura, Seiichi Akutsu, Hirosuke Fukuda

Patent number: 3956385Abstract: Sulfonylamide derivatives of the formula,RSO.sub.2 NHC.sub.2 H.sub.4 Clwherein R is an alkyl or a phenyl group, which are particularly useful for the production of photographic chemicals, are prepared by the reaction between a sulfonylhalide of the formula,RSO.sub.2 Xwherein R is as defined above, and X is chlorine or bromine, and 2-chloroethylamine or its salt, which is prepared by the chlorination of monoethanolamine with thionylchloride.Type: GrantFiled: April 16, 1974Date of Patent: May 11, 1976Assignee: Sumitomo Chemical Company, LimitedInventors: Hideaki Suda, Tatsuo Kanda, Hiroshige Tomita, Hirotoshi Nakanishi, Hiromu Hida, Tatsumi Nuno, Seiichi Akutsu, Masayuki Maeyashiki
